Parker's Cement Innovation Promises Marblelike Structures

Parker's Cement from New York claims a rapid transformation of shapeless mortar into dense rock like granite. The inventor describes a process yielding clear sonorous material, capable of forming elegant 16 by 20 foot structures with no doors or windows. He plans a street of similar edifices at his own cost, asserting greater durability than brick, marble, or Evanite.

Therapy Method For Stammerers From A Historical Text

The passage outlines a three day silence period with tongue pressing and deep inspiration. Small rolls under the tongue guide direction during speech, followed by reading aloud for an hour to the doctor. Breathing must be controlled, with frequent stops to re inspire, and the tongue tip kept floating to avoid sinking.

Two Local Boys Die in Gig Accident Near Elizabeth City

On Tuesday two youths, sons of Dr. Samuel Mathews and Mr. Willis Wilson of Camden County, left town in a gig. After eight miles a wheel struck a stump, the gig capsized, Stephen Wilson was killed instantly, the horse bolted, and the vehicle was destroyed.

New Baptist Paper Planned by Montpelier Minister

The Rev dole Monroe of Montpelier North Carolina proposes a Baptist paper in large imperial Svo pages to be issued semi monthly. It aims to advance religion and missionary work with all profits to charity. Subscriptions set at 50 cents yearly and tiered gifts depend on subscriber counts.

Speaker Defends Right to Instruct Congress Members

Mr. Fisher argued that instructing Senators and Representatives in Congress was a right of the people, not a restraint on private citizens. He criticized a proposed resolution as arbitrary and anti democratic, stressing that the Constitution protects instruction within representative government and warning opponents of undermining free institutions.

Political Reflections On Parties And Presidential Prospects

The article argues for Republican alignment with Thomas Jefferson’s ideals, condemns Federalists and Adams era policies, and supports Van Buren’s candidacy while warning against Opposition tactics. It discusses party strategies, potential caucuses, and views on slavery, banking, and national policies. It cites New York Star and Boston Atlas critiques, and notes Webster, Clay, Harrison, and White as referenced figures.
